How Inpatient Rehabilitation Works - Quartzsite, AZ.

At the moment, inpatient drug and alcohol rehabilitation is ranked among the most effective types of rehabilitation available. Whether you make a conscious decision to enter rehab on your own or a loved one does it for you, this might be the first step you take towards a life that is free from alcohol, drugs, and other addictive substances.

The center you choose will also provide you with various programs to meet your particular needs. It will, for instance, offer you a variety of evidence-based practices, services, and tools to ensure that you begin, undergo, and complete the healing process as successfully as possible.

Your participation, as well as the cooperation and support of your family and loved ones, may also make a world of difference and have the best impact on your chances of success.

In many cases, you will find that inpatient drug and alcohol rehab centers have programs that will ask that you stay in residence so that you can receive around the clock monitoring, help, and care.

The addiction treatment center might also limit your contact with the outside world to the bare minimum and also administer arbitrary drug tests on a weekly basis (or even more frequently) to ensure that you are always on track with your recovery. You may additionally receive medical therapy and a variety of treatments during your stay.

The length of inpatient alcohol and drug rehab will mostly depend on your needs. However, some of these programs run for about 30 days. Some insurance companies also pay for 30 days while Medicare only pays for a maximum of 30 days. This is why one month (roughly) is the ideal length of the program.

However, if you are paying for yourself, you may stay longer - 3 months, a year, or even longer. It will all depend on the nature of the program, your health, and the severity of your substance use disorder.

Success With Inpatient Alcohol And Drug Rehabilitation

To get the most from the rehabilitation program, you must be ready for a long term recovery process. As reported by NTASM.

The group did a 6-yr analysis from 2005 to 2011, the findings of which showed that one third of the 341,741 individuals in the study, successfully recovered from their drug and alcohol abuse disorder and went on to live a sober life in the long term.

To this end, you should keep in mind that getting the most from treatment will involve more than just showing up to group and therapy sessions. You also need to participate and be open minded and willing to change.

A different SAMHSA survey conducted in 2009 showed that about 23.5 million people aged above 12 years required active treatment for alcohol or drug abuse. Once you accept that you are addicted to alcohol or drugs, what follows should be to seek rehab and help.

However, this step may not be a simple one to take. Of the 23.5 million people that SAMHSA identified as in need of help, only about eleven percent or just over two and a half million got the help they required at an alcohol and drug treatment facility in Quartzsite, AZ.

That said, you may want to remember that the inpatient alcohol and drug rehabilitation program you will attend probably comprehends that yours should be an individualized care. In the same way that everyone responds to medicine differently, no two clients suffering from substance use issues will receive the same kind of in-patient substance abuse rehab.

With this in mind, therefore, the center needs to provide a variety of services - including wellness workshops, therapy, art workshops, group therapy, individual therapy, medication assisted therapy (MAT), and education classes, among other things. All of these treatments will occur during the week as part and parcel of a more comprehensive - albeit individually curated - rehab schedule.

The services provided are clinically-based and intensive. They also use protocols that have been scientifically proven to help people with your condition handle the triggers of their substance abuse issue.

In Addition, in-patient drug and alcohol rehab will help you learn how for a thought and behavior change as you start progressing toward a sober life. Since the methods are designed so the focal point is you as a whole individual, therefore all your vital spiritual, social, psychological, emotional, and physical needs will be catered to.

Besides the clinically-based services you will be given for your alcohol and drug addiction, the staff might also use proof-based protocols (including but not limited to DBT or Dialectical Behavior Therapy) to deal with those issues you might struggle with - such as co-occurring disorders.
